Sharing personal moments with Friends

Roughly every two to three months I send an email with some personal updates to Friends of DD. Inspired by my friend Harry, about a year ago or so, I started adding a handful of photos from my personal life to each update: of our building’s gardening day, a weekend of hiking at a local national park, or a neighbour’s dog that I borrowed for a walk.

Rather surprisingly, those photos have become the most appreciated and commented-on part of my Friends updates. Sharing personal moments with a more intimate sub-group of readers feels special. It reminds me of the days of Flickr and personal blogs.

At first, I was hesitant to share shots of my private life with ‘internet strangers’, but I realised that a modest paywall serves as a great screening process. Those who have made a generous commitment to supporting my work deserve to get a bit more of me. 😉
